Question 2 of 5

A client has been tentatively diagnosed with Graves' disease (hyperthyroidism). Which of these findings noted on the initial nursing assessment requires quick intervention by the nurse?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Exophthalmos or protruding eyeballs is a distinctive characteristic of Graves' Disease. It can result in corneal abrasions with severe eye pain or damage when the eyelid is unable to blink down over the protruding eyeball. Eye drops or ointment may be needed.

Question 3 of 5

The nurse is evaluating the security of the client's tracheostomy ties. Which of the following methods is used to assess for tie tightness?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: Placing one finger between the tie and neck ensures ties are secure but not overly tight, preventing tissue damage or airway obstruction.
